Every year the Risk Management Agency has filed for Iberville Parish is in the series below, from 2019 to 2024. Read across those years the county’s annual loss ratio — indemnity divided by premium — runs from 1.21 at the low end to 4.02 at the high end, with 3.19 in the middle. The worst year filed is 2020, at 4.21. The band points are years the county actually ran, never a figure interpolated between two of them.

County cause-of-loss figures from the USDA Risk Management Agency’s Cause of Loss Summary of Business, county files, filed by the agency as a United States Government work. The loss ratio is the agency’s own published column: indemnity divided by premium, re-derived at the summed county-crop grain.
